Located in a lush setting on the banks of Jackson Lake, Colter Bay Campground has large sites for tents and dry camping for RVs. Each site includes a picnic table and fire pit, with nearby flush bathrooms.
In addition to hiking trails, Colter Bay Village is a hub of outdoor recreation, including horseback riding, scenic lake cruises, guided fishing trips, and nightly ranger talks. Additional amenities found within the village include two restaurants, grocery store, marina and launderette with pay showers, retail stores, and visitor center with a museum.
Campsites are available on a first come basis, advance reservations are only taken for group sites.
Directions:
From the entrance off Hwy. 89 N. at the Moran Junction, proceed on Hwy. 89 for 10 mi. to the Colter Bay Village Junction.
